基于CANopen协议的刮板输送机功率协调控制系统研究 被引量:2

摘要 在对SGD730/320B型刮板输送机基本结构进行概述的基础上,结合设备机头和机尾双电机驱动的特点,基于CANopen协议设计了功率协调控制系统。系统包含2个CANopen从站、CANopen主站和CANopen总线。CANopen主站中使用的PLC控制器型号为S7-1200,CANopen从站中使用的变频器型号为台达C2000系列。系统主要是对2台电动机的扭矩进行检测,并将其控制在系统设定的阈值范围内,达到功率协调的效果。将系统部署到煤矿工程实践中,经现场测试发现效果良好,系统可以将机头和机尾电机的功率差值控制在5%内,为刮板输送机的稳定可靠运行创造了良好的条件。 Based on the overview of the basic structure of the SGD730/320B scraper conveyor,combined with the characteristics of the double motor drive of the equipment head and tail,a power coordination control system was designed based on the CANopen protocol.The system includes 2 CANopen slave stations,CANopen master stations,and CANopen buses.The PLC controller model used in the CANopen master station is S7-1200,and the inverter model used in the CANopen slave station is Delta C2000 series.The system mainly detects the torque of the two motors and controls it within the threshold range set by the system to achieve the effect of power coordination.The system was deployed in the practice of coal mine engineering,and it was found that the effect was good after on-site testing.The system can control the power difference between the head and tail motors within 5%,creating good conditions for the stable and reliable operation of the scraper conveyor.
